A vulnerability was found in Linux, FreeBSD, OpenBSD, MacOS, iOS and Android. It has been classified as critical. This impacts an unknown function of the component VPN Handler. Performing a manipulation as part of Stream results in channel accessible. This vulnerability is identified as CVE-2019-14899. The attack can only be performed from the local network. There is not any exploit available. Due to its background and reception, this vulnerability has an historic impact.

A vulnerability, which was classified as critical, was found in Linux, FreeBSD, OpenBSD, MacOS, iOS and Android (Operating System). This affects an unknown code block of the component VPN Handler. The manipulation as part of a Stream leads to a channel accessible vulnerability. CWE is classifying the issue as CWE-300. The product does not adequately verify the identity of actors at both ends of a communication channel, or does not adequately ensure the integrity of the channel, in a way that allows the channel to be accessed or influenced by an actor that is not an endpoint. This is going to have an impact on confidentiality, integrity, and availability. The summary by CVE is:

A vulnerability was discovered in Linux, FreeBSD, OpenBSD, MacOS, iOS, and Android that allows a malicious access point, or an adjacent user, to determine if a connected user is using a VPN, make positive inferences about the websites they are visiting, and determine the correct sequence and acknowledgement numbers in use, allowing the bad actor to inject data into the TCP stream. This provides everything that is needed for an attacker to hijack active connections inside the VPN tunnel.
